Japan Solid De-icer Market Overview

The Japan Solid De-icer Market has experienced steady growth driven by the country’s harsh winter conditions, particularly in the northern regions such as Hokkaido and Tohoku. The increasing frequency of snowfalls and the need to maintain transportation safety have amplified demand for effective de-icing products. Solid de-icers, including rock salt and other mineral-based compounds, are favored for their cost-effectiveness and ease of application, especially in large-scale outdoor settings like highways, airports, and railway tracks. The market is also influenced by Japan’s focus on safety regulations and infrastructure resilience, prompting government and private sector investments in advanced de-icing solutions. Moreover, environmental considerations are shaping product development, with a growing preference for eco-friendly de-icers that minimize ecological impact while maintaining efficacy. The market landscape is competitive, with local manufacturers and international players innovating to meet the evolving needs of consumers and regulatory standards.

Japan Solid De-icer Market By Type Segment Analysis

The Japan solid de-icer market is primarily classified into calcium chloride, magnesium chloride, sodium chloride, potassium chloride, and blended formulations. Calcium chloride remains the dominant segment, owing to its superior melting performance at lower temperatures and rapid action, especially in harsh winter conditions typical of northern Japan. Magnesium chloride and sodium chloride follow, with magnesium chloride gaining traction due to its lower environmental impact and reduced corrosion effects on infrastructure. The market size for calcium chloride is estimated to account for approximately 55-60% of the total solid de-icer market, translating to an estimated value of around USD 150 million in 2023. Magnesium chloride holds roughly 20-25%, with sodium chloride comprising the remaining 15-20%. The blended formulations, which combine multiple salts for optimized performance, are emerging as a niche but rapidly growing segment, driven by innovations in formulation technology and environmental regulations.

The fastest-growing segment within the solid de-icer market is magnesium chloride, projected to grow at a CAGR of approximately 4-5% over the next five years. This growth is fueled by increasing environmental awareness, stricter regulations on chloride runoff, and the development of eco-friendly formulations. The calcium chloride segment is mature, with steady but slower growth, reflecting its established dominance. Magnesium chloride and blended formulations are in the growth stage, characterized by technological advancements and expanding application scopes. Innovations such as low-temperature melting formulations and environmentally benign blends are key growth accelerators, enhancing product efficacy and sustainability. The impact of emerging technologies, including biodegradable carriers and enhanced delivery systems, is expected to further boost market penetration and product differentiation, especially in urban and commercial infrastructure applications.

Japan Solid De-icer Market By Application Segment Analysis

The application landscape for solid de-icers in Japan encompasses road and highway maintenance, airport runway de-icing, commercial and industrial facilities, and residential use. Road and highway applications dominate the market, accounting for approximately 70% of total demand, due to Japan’s extensive network of public roads and the necessity for winter safety measures in northern regions. Airport runway de-icing is also a significant segment, driven by the need to ensure operational safety during snow and ice conditions, especially at major hubs such as Tokyo and Sapporo. Commercial and industrial applications, including parking lots, rail stations, and logistics centers, are witnessing increased adoption, supported by urban infrastructure modernization and heightened safety standards. Residential use, while smaller in volume, is growing steadily, particularly in snow-prone suburban areas where homeowners seek effective de-icing solutions.

The market size for road and highway applications is estimated at around USD 200 million in 2023, representing the largest share. The airport runway segment is valued at approximately USD 50-60 million, with steady growth expected due to increased air travel and safety regulations. The commercial and industrial segment is expanding at a CAGR of about 3-4%, driven by urban infrastructure upgrades and stricter safety compliance. The residential segment, though smaller, is experiencing a compound annual growth rate of approximately 2-3%, influenced by changing consumer preferences for environmentally friendly and effective de-icing products. The growth stage varies across segments, with road and airport applications being mature, while residential and commercial sectors are in the emerging to growing phases. Key growth drivers include technological innovations in eco-friendly de-icers, increased government mandates for safety, and rising urbanization, which collectively foster demand for reliable and sustainable de-icing solutions.
